I doubt very much if your problem is Gout.

Symptoms of Gout develop quickly (sometimes in 1 day) and typically occur in only one joint at a time.
http://www.podiatrychannel.com/gout/

Gout usually develops in the joint of the first toe (i.e., the big toe, or hallux). Common symptoms include the following:

* Inflammation
* Pain
* Redness
* Stiffness
* Swelling

If it hurts under your heel, you may have one or more conditions that inflame the tissues on the bottom of your foot:
http://orthoinfo.aaos.org/fact/thr_repor...

The most common form of heel pain in active people is known as Plantar Fasciitis (pronounced PLAN-tar fashee-EYE-tiss). It occurs when the long, flat ligament on the bottom of the foot (Plantar Fascia) stretches irregularly and develops small tears that cause the ligament to become inflamed.
